Microsoft has Acquired ADRM Software
Redmond, WA – 18th June 2020 - Microsoft has acquired ADRM Software, a data analytics firm that builds models for businesses and industry services. Announcing the deal in a blog, Ravi Krishnaswamy, CVP, Azure Global Industry, said: “Data and AI are the foundation of modern technological innovation, yet businesses today struggle to unlock the full value data has to offer as fragmented data estates hinder digital transformation. Without a comprehensive and integrated view of their data, companies are at a competitive disadvantage, which hinders digital adoption and data-driven innovation. Today, we are excited to announce the acquisition of ADRM Software, a leading provider of large-scale industry data models, which are used by large companies worldwide as information blueprints. ADRM’s robust industry data models have been built and refined over decades for business-critical analytics.” Terms of the transaction were not disclosed.

MTBC Acquires Meridian Medical Management, a Former GE Healthcare IT Company
Somerset, NJ - 17th June 2020 - MTBC, Inc, a provider of cloud-based healthcare IT solutions and services, has announced the closing of its acquisition of Meridian Medical Management, a former GE Healthcare IT company that delivers advanced healthcare information technology solutions and services to thousands of healthcare providers nationwide. Stephen Snyder, CEO of MTBC, said: “Meridian is our largest acquisition to date. We expect to provide increased revenue guidance as part of our second quarter investors call as a result of this transaction. We also believe that Meridian’s team, digital assets, and customer base will help further accelerate our growth and margin expansion during 2021 and beyond.”

IBM Acquires Assets from Spanugo
Armonk, New York – 15th June 2020 - IBM has announced it has signed a definitive agreement to acquire Spanugo, a US-based provider of cloud cybersecurity posture management solutions. To further meet the security demands of its clients in highly regulated industries, IBM will integrate Spanugo software into its public cloud. The addition of Spanugo software will help accelerate the availability of a security control center that will enable IBM clients to define compliance profiles, manage controls and, in continuous real time, monitor compliance across their organization. "IBM is committed to building the industry's most secure and open public cloud for business. With the acquisition of Spanugo, we have taken another major step in advancing IBM's differentiated capabilities in security and compliance for our enterprise clients, including those in highly regulated industries," said Howard Boville, SVP, Cloud, IBM. "Bringing Spanugo's technology into our financial services public cloud will help provide our clients with evidence of their ongoing compliance, in real time."

Perficient Announces Acquisition of PSL
Saint Louis – 17th June 2020 - Digital consultancy transforming the world’s largest enterprises and biggest brands, Perficient, Inc., has announced the acquisition of Productora de Software S.A.S. (“PSL”), a $33 million annual revenue nearshore software development company, based in Medellin, Colombia, with additional locations in Bogota and Cali, Colombia. The acquisition is expected to be accretive to adjusted earnings per share immediately.  Perficient’s Chairman & CEO, Jeffrey Davis, said: “We are excited to strengthen our global delivery capabilities with the strategic acquisition of nearshore software development firm PSL. The need for our clients to adapt and innovate rapidly has never been more critical, especially in today’s unprecedented environment. PSL brings the highest quality custom application and software development services from its centers in Colombia. We’re thrilled to add their nearshore software development expertise to further enhance our existing global capabilities and help our clients accelerate innovation and speed time to market.”

SiriusXM Acquires Podcast Management and Analytics Platform Simplecast
New York – 17th June 2020 - SiriusXM has announced the acquisition of Simplecast, a podcast management platform that enables podcasters to publish, manage and measure their content.  The Simplecast solution, paired with the award-winning monetization platform of AdsWizz, the adtech subsidiary of SiriusXM, creates an end-to-end solution that enables creators to publish and generate revenue from their podcasts, all in one place. Led by Founder & CEO, Brad Smith, the Simplecast platform is employed by a wide range of creators, from enterprise-level publishers and networks to independent niche podcasters. With its content management, audience analytics and dynamic audio toolset, MAE (Moveable Audio Engine), it has attracted some of the largest and most highly respected brands and publishers. Alexis van de Wyer, CEO of AdsWizz, said: "Our goal is to provide audio publishers with state-of-the-art platforms and give them everything they need to be successful. Empowering podcasters of any size to create, distribute, analyze and monetize their work is the next natural step in pursuing our vision."

Accenture Announces Intent to Acquire Sentelis
Paris – 15th June 2020 – Accenture has entered into an agreement to acquire Sentelis, an independent data consulting and engineering company, headquartered in France, that specializes in designing and scaling data and artificial intelligence (AI) capabilities. Sentelis would join Accenture Applied Intelligence and complement its focus on helping clients build the right data strategy and foundation to industrialize AI across their businesses. The acquisition will strengthen Accenture’s growing analytics, AI and ML/data engineering business in France. Global growth in AI client engagements has also served as a driver for Accenture’s recent acquisitions of Analytics8 in Australia, Pragsis Bidoop in Spain, Clarity Insights in North America, Mudano in the UK and Byte Prophecy in India.

Net Element to Merge with Electric Vehicle Company Mullen Technologies
Miami, FL – 15th June 2020 - Net Element, Inc, a global technology and value-added solutions group that supports electronic payments acceptance in a multi-channel environment including point-of-sale, e-commerce and mobile devices, has announced that it has entered into a binding Letter of Intent to merge with privately-held Mullen Technologies, Inc, a Southern California-based electric vehicle company in a stock-for-stock reverse merger in which Mullen's stockholders will receive the majority of the outstanding stock in the post-merger Company. Founded in 2014, Mullen expects to launch the Dragonfly K50, a luxury sports car, in the first half of 2021 through ICI (Independent Commercial Importers). Mullen currently has eight retail locations in California and one in Arizona.

Sinch Acquires ACL Mobile Expands to India
Stockholm, Sweden – 15th June 2020 - Sinch AB, a company specialising in cloud communications for mobile customer engagement, has entered into a definitive agreement to acquire ACL Mobile Limited for a total cash consideration of INR 5,350 million. ACL Mobile is a provider of cloud communications services in India and Southeast Asia. Its platform enables businesses to interact with their customers through multiple channels, including SMS, voice, email, IP messaging and WhatsApp. The company serves more than 500 enterprise customers and is particularly successful in the Banking and Financial Services industry, where ACL’s proprietary Axiom platform offers intelligent routing and granular access controls that specifically caters to the stringent security requirements of demanding financial institutions. The company employs 288 people with headquarters in Delhi and overseas offices in Dubai (UAE) and Kuala Lumpur (Malaysia). Commenting, Sinch CEO, Oscar Werner, said: “With ACL we gain critical scale in the world’s second largest mobile market. We gain customers, expertise and technology and we further strengthen our global messaging product for discerning businesses with global needs.”

Calligo acquires Itomic Voice & Data
Dublin & Cork, Ireland - 16th June - Caligo, the world’s first end-to-end managed data services provider, has announced it has acquired Itomic Voice & Data Ltd., a Cork- and Dublin-based IT managed services provider, specialising in delivering IT solutions and maintenance and managed Microsoft 365 and Azure services nationwide. The purchase of Itomic Voice & Data is Calligo’s seventh acquisition in three years and follows January 2020’s acquisition of Dublin-based DC Networks. These two acquisitions combine to make Calligo one of the largest IT managed service providers in Ireland, and the only one to offer data privacy support at the heart of every service. Caligo has operations in Ireland, Canada, the US, the UK, the Channel Islands and Luxembourg, with customers worldwide. Commenting, Julian Box, Founder and CEO of Calligo, said: “We focused our current expansion strategy on Ireland because of its growing number of innovative businesses developing new data-reliant tools and services.” Terms of the deal were not disclosed.

Babel Street Acquires Dunami
Washington – 8th June 2020 - Babel Street, Inc., a data-to-knowledge company, has announced it has acquired all of the intellectual property assets of Dunami. The acquired technology leverages advanced artificial intelligence (AI) and machine learning (ML) to swiftly understand topics and thought leaders as well as conduct relationship analysis of associated networks and audiences. The technology automatically compiles and visualizes these relationships enabling more fulsome analysis. Specifically, it will help users identify the intersection of key trends and influential voices from publicly available information (PAI) across more than 200 languages. The IP will be integrated into the Babel Street product suite -- Babel X® and Babel BOX®. While the integration is already underway, the technology is available as a stand-alone offering to Babel Street customers. Founder and CEO, Jeff Chapman, said: “This technology is a natural complement to our features and functionality as well as our diverse data offering. We are proud to bring our clients these advanced capabilities that will enhance the speed and quality of their decision making.”

ReNew Power Acquires Climate Connect
New Delhi, India - 4th June 2020 - ReNew Power, India’s largest renewable energy company, has signed a definitive agreement to acquire Climate Connect. The team, IT systems and platforms, data integrity, and business development activities will continue to operate separately. The acquisition gives ReNew access to Climate Connect’s full suite of market-leading energy-AI management services, ML-software development, and unique blend of power sector knowledge. Speaking on the acquisition, Sumant Sinha, CMD of ReNew Power said: “I am thrilled to welcome Climate Connect into the fold, to make India's power markets more efficient through next-generation AI-and-ML-powered technologies. The first wave of growth in the renewable energy industry came through the addition of physical assets on the ground. The next wave will come through the development of digital products that help optimize power flow from generators to distribution companies to customers. As distribution companies look to tighten operations, find efficiencies, and reduce AT&C losses, digitalization will play a key role and Climate Connect is well-positioned to service this nationally important market.”
